My Travel Journal

- Mediguro -
24th of April, 2018
I've decided to leave the place I've called home since I was a hatchling, the thought of having the adventure of a lifetime is too sweet to resist; May whichever great diety who's lands I end up in protect me, and guide me as I travel into the unknown.
Hopefully to return from whence i came with many stories to tell.


- (voidofinsanity) -
(25th of April, 2018)
I began by flying to the very northern area of my ice wonderland home. It was not the bright green that first caught my eye, nor the vibrate purple glow, but the red sense of danger that drew my attention. I skipped those places, first to encounter a real challenge, the corrupted lands of plague. It was frightening, but exciting all in the same emotion! The world was bare of any real sign of plant life. The creatures looked barely alive, but seemed to have a fierce energy. There was a constant battle between one entity and the next. I wanted to experience this land in it's struggle as soon as I could. So I found the first dragons I could, and introduced myself!
The dragons I found were an odd mix. Half seemed as though they were walking zombies, flesh rotting from their bones. The others were vibrant artists, and story tellers! The creatives seemed to come here from different lands, all finding a common ground here in the barren wastelands. One of the artists (Mael), even thought I was pretty, so he used various colored coals to draw a picture of me!
All was exciting, until their self proclaimed leader showed up. His aura was dark, and his broken, yet stern posture was even more vile. He did not take kindly to my being a stranger in his territory. Thankfully the creatives spoke in my favor. He agreed to let me leave safely, if I could survive a night of battling creatures. How crude he was! I had never battled before! But I suppose it was this, or death by his filthy claws. So I did what he asked.
It was scary at first, but I did it! I held my own! Their leader did not seem impressed, but he did what he said, and had his more wicked appearing comrades lead me through safely. I learned a lot from this place though, I am glad it was my first choice!

- Strukla -
(22nd of May, 2018)
Obtained:

White Cabbage Butterfly Mobile Stick Ruby-Throated Hummingbird Old World Rabbit Pretty Pink Arm Bow
Next stop on my travels were the Windy plains. Although it seemed rather boring to hang around, I still did it in hopes of finding a decent challenge in whatever form it may come. I traveled from Clan to Clan, from the grassy steppes to the harsh cliffs many locals used to jump off and glide into the air.
While staring at them, some as young as a day or two yet so fearless, I seemed to have caught someone's eye. He looked at me with a grin and I could tell he was strong, despite being on the smaller end of the stick as far as Guardians go. As he spread his wings, the blue crystal at the tips of his ribbons chimed against his cloak made of something stronger than cloth; perhaps some sort of metal. All of a sudden, he lunged at me.
All that forced fighting in the Plague lands now became my advantage as my speed and agility countered his weight and strength. It was obvious he was a much more experienced fighter than I was, but I was not about to bow down and let myself be beaten! Soon enough, it became obvious he was not planning to harm me; but it was more like some sort of a battle training, a friendly tussle, if you wish to call it so. It took me off guard, of course, but soon after, I too got wrapped up into it and even enjoyed the sudden adrenaline rush and trying to outwit this unsuspecting partner o' mine.
in such a way; it will surely help me on my travelIn the end, my thin and nimble body came out victorious, as I managed to wrap it around his, forcing him to stomp his foot on the ground and admit defeat after a few unsuccessful attempts in freeing himself off my grip. Only then had I noticed that we gathered a rather big crowd that must've cheered us on as we were going at it, but now went silent. Perhaps fighting with one of them was not the smartest move, and I became slightly agitated with their quiet stares. A quick thought made me decide it would be best to leave before they take me for a serious threat of sorts. Yet, as I rose up into the air, my sparring partner stomped his foot again.
As I looked down, I saw him grinning back at me, but not in an unfriendly, evil way. With a sweep of his tail, something flew towards me, a bag of sorts (how did it turn up there, I never noticed) and instinctively, I wafted at it but then realized it was just a piece of cloth with a string tied on top. Managing to grab it before it hit the ground, we exchanged wordless nods and I left, daring to open it only when I deemed I was far enough from his Clan. In it was enough food to last me at least two days! Pleased with myself, I continued my journey, using the string that tied the bag to make a bow for myself, and a reminder of how capable of being on my own I already became. - MaplesHaiku -
June 9th, 2018
Next, I headed up to the murky woodlands where the dragons of Shadow resided. For miles, all I could see is night and fog swirling around me. Only the glowing mushrooms guided my way through the brambles, and many times have I gotten tangled in them. Food was scarce and hard to catch, and I had already tore through my rations, leaving me starving for days. After a few days in this land, a flash of purple caught my eye. Looking around, I saw a dragon like myself, nimbly twisting his way through the natural hazards without getting himself caught in it. Seeing him, I thought that maybe he could help me. I spoke up, calling for help. My cry immediately grabbed his attention, and the other dragon flew over to me. Seeing his purple eyes, I knew immediately that this was a child of the Shadowbinder, the flight's reigning deity. I asked him to help guide me through this maze, and he gladly accepted.

My hunger was clawing at me, but this dragon was adept at feeding himself, having lived here for all of his life. After one of his catches, a hellbender, I asked him if I could have it. However, shadows engulfed it before he replied. He remained rather light-hearted about it, saying it was unfortunate. I let out a groan. Quickly, the shadows dissipated, revealing the hellbender to the twilight. The purple dragon chuckled at his little trick, and happily gave me it. I had never liked amphibians, preferring insects over them, but it was the best meal I had tasted in a while. Perhaps hunger played a role.

I thanked him, and asked him his name. Nightshade was his reply. I told him mine, too. We continued to travel, and he even shared his catches with me. Hours later, we had reached a staircase where brilliant light started to touch the sunken land, turning the grass to a yellow-green color. I squinted. Days in the darkness had taken a toll on my eyesight, and now, I was especially sensitive to the light. Giving Nightshade one last thank you, I dashed into the light, hoping for a peaceful rest. From there, I would continue my journey.

September 19, 2018
My next stop were the great spires of crystal, on the edges of Arcane land. I had never seen anything so strange - pink crags of glittering rock soaring higher than I could even fly. For all its beauty, it seemed rather barren, until I caught sight of a network of little caves and paths carved into the spires above my head. I wondered who could possibly make their home up there.

Surprisingly, there were many dragons there, of varying species, even; the only things they seemed to have in common were the red shades of their scales and the scrolls they clung to, aside from the more colourful dragons I presumed were visitors like myself. They lead me to the back and I was met with an odd little fae by the name of Tabantha, who had seemed to be in the middle of charting a constellation. There was an air of authority about her, so I had no doubt when she introduced herself as their director. Despite this, she was a rather friendly creature, even taking the time to set down her charts and show me around their facilities. The Highspine Archives, they were called. Tabantha explained that they existed to catalogue various findings from their lands and beyond, and that they were rather popular with travellers seeking knowledge; at this point, she added they had both good and not-so-good items here, and that I should be careful what I touch.

Old parchments and glowing runes weren't the only things I found here. On my first day, I was introduced to the many various residents; while the vast majority of them were kindly enough to look up from their work and chatter a little, I came upon Rybak. An imperial of crimson and gold hue, he seemed in temper firey as the sheen of his scales, not even looking up from his records and even snapping bitterly at me when I offered conversation. I was sure I wouldn't be striking up anything with him soon, but, as fate may have it, I did. Later in the evening, he asked for me to forgive him for how he acted — being holed up and surrounded by old papers all the time could do that to you. As it turned out, we had a lot in common: we both held deep curiosity about the world, and longed to explore it. Fate seemed to take another turn, for soon I had a family of my own. Four hatchlings, named Hebras, Arcmist, Kesan, and, at Rybak's request, Aerwyn. I even befriended one of the many native sakura owls that nested near the spines, Remura, who became my constant companion.

I knew I wanted to adventure beyond the archives, even then, but I am not so heartless as to leave forever. I plan, and promised, to visit often, and I do not break my promises. For now, I take my leave, Remura by my side and a pearl ring, a gift from Rybak and a reminder of this place, on my claw.
